This module provides a deep dive into the technical foundations of the 5G air interface, 5G New Radio (NR). We will explore the physical layer that makes high-speed, low-latency communication possible.

The journey begins with the 5G Spectrum and the OFDMA waveform, which constructs the 5G Resource Grid. You will learn how data is structured into frames, modulated, and coded (Modulation and Coding Schemes) for transmission. We'll demystify key procedures like Initial Access, facilitated by the Synchronization Signal Block (SSB), and the crucial role of the Scheduler in dynamic Resource Allocation.

This technical exploration covers the essential components—from Downlink Signals & Channels and flexible Bandwidth Parts (BWP) to Duplex methods—that collectively define the performance and capabilities of the 5G radio link.
